The Power of Your It Factor
Each of us has something I like to call the “It Factor”—that unique combination of knowledge, skills, and passions that sets us apart. The challenge is that we often underestimate the value of these gifts. We might assume that if something comes naturally to us, it must come easily to everyone else too. But that’s far from the truth.
Your It Factor is where your potential to create impact lies. It’s in the way you solve problems, share ideas, or connect with others. It’s in the knowledge you’ve gained through experience, the skills you’ve sharpened over time, and the passions that drive you to keep learning and growing.
From Passion to Purpose
Turning your expertise into something meaningful starts with recognizing that your skills have value. It’s not about how much money you can make right away; it’s about finding ways to use your talents in a way that brings fulfillment to both yourself and others. Whether you’re mentoring someone, sharing your knowledge in a blog, or creating content that inspires, the impact you make is significant.
I’ve found that when we focus on serving others with our gifts, opportunities for growth naturally follow. It’s about shifting our mindset from “How can I make more money?” to “How can I use my talents to make a difference?” This approach not only leads to financial success but also to a deeper sense of purpose and satisfaction.
